Download Latest Version AlefoxRelease1.zip (2.7 MB)
Email in envelope

Get an email when there's a new version of Alefox

Home / Alefox Releases
Name Modified Size InfoDownloads / Week
Parent folder
Release 1 for Firefox 1.5.0.5 2006-07-31
Totals: 1 Item   0